Recently, I was talking to the manager of TMS Film Props, New Zealand, regarding screen-used LOTR props, and why they are so hard to find, and extremely limited, when there was sooooo much made for filming. He told me that the reason was because due to the lawsuit between Peter Jackson, and Newline, all the screen-used props are in a warehouse in New Zealand awaiting the litigation to sort out before they could be sold. Now that the lawsuit is "done", maybe some or all of that will be released!!! This is all just hearsay, of course, but worth keeping an ear, and eye out for. This is a pretty reliable source, as it was TMS that recieved the original cloak pins from Warren Green that were used on all 3 LOTR sets. The reason these cloak pins were released for sale is due to Warren's pin design existing before the movie went into production, and the design remains his property. I recently emailed WETA to try and get an update on all the original trilogy props they made, and they're possible availability. This was the very prompt response I recieved:

"Thank you for your email.
All of the props, costumes etc that we design and make for films is the Intellectual Property of the funding studio, i.e. New Line Cinema for The Lord of the Rings.
Therefore, all of the material is in secure storage and we are unable to loan, rent, sell or replicate.
Sorry for the somewhat disappointing response, but I trust you can appreciate our position.
